 · The Difference Between FHA and Conventional Loans. What is the difference between FHA and conventional loans? There are actually several. As Investopedia explains, conventional loans are loans that are not insured by the federal government. In contrast, an FHA loan is guaranteed by the Federal Housing Administration, which reduces the lender’s risk.
